Output 43c21ec612918d6c7360f362837bd564f135b373ccef72cdf7fd4c59617c75fc:0
- value
- 2657626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f0e306952b46ab50a435215fe2ac2c6a61efb08 OP_EQUAL
- address
- 3AMd7eJy6bmueNN9NsR8h16vRX1ETmPZ7s
- transaction
- 43c21ec612918d6c7360f362837bd564f135b373ccef72cdf7fd4c59617c75fc